Pros

SS&C has some extremely bright minds and hard workers. You can work from home from time to time The dress code is Casual Dress

Cons

There is very little room for growth or advancement with SS&C. Once hired at this company you might as well look at it as a paycheck or place holder until you can find something else. The company markets itself as a software company but puts no money or resources into the enhancement of their software packages. There is no structure or accountability nor are there any real rewards. Upper management is clueless and refuses to learn or address the current problems. The common practice is to create a process, but not one that will be enforced or followed. It is merely put in place to point the finger at someone else if unrealistic deadlines are missed. This company is very much focused on Sales. Sell it now, build it later. If the client gets upset…that’s okay…there are more out there. Client retention is rapidly decreasing. The executive level of the company is a joke. Emails from Bill Stone are printed and hung up around the office for people to laugh at. They rarely make sense and if they do they are in no way inspiring. Bill may want to start writing them around 1pm instead of 1am. Bonus and Raises are small and constantly months late with very little of a performance review. Goals for the next year and career growth are very unclear and often ignored. It is unfortunate the company doesn’t realize what it is doing. They have some extremely bright people who what to work and are proud of their work, but with no recognition or rewards that talent is exiting quickly.

Pros

- Hybrid/remote, only required to work in the office 3 days a month - Quarterly bonuses - 401k matching

Cons

- Cannot overstate how understaffed the department is. We are expected to manage enormous volumes with a dwindling team because the company will not replace anyone who leaves. They also will not let go of poor performers, because they know upper management will not replace them. This means that there are team members who have been on the team 3+ years that are still unable to perform even the most basic job duties without assistance, performing at just 30% of the productivity quota, and even no call no showing with zero consequences while the rest of the team is expected to pick up their slack. This creates a toxic work environment and meetings filled with constant frustration and hostility. - The high volumes result in frequent "mandatory" overtime. However, because of the lack of consequences, poor performers frequently leave before the work is done and saddle the rest of the team with additional work. - Management is a joke. Incredibly unprofessional, lack of communication, and creates a hectic, disorganized environment. No support is provided to employees and even the most basic manager duties are offloaded onto already overworked team members because management is too incompetent to do their own jobs. - COLA and yearly pay increases are laughable at 2% or less. - Company invests heavily in automation and offshoring processes to avoid hiring new employees and paying a living wage. Both of these result in poor quality work that creates more work for onshore employees. - "Unlimited" PTO depends heavily on the department. It can be difficult to request time off and calendars fill up quickly. It also cannot be used for doctor's appointments or unplanned sick days, and the company only offers 5 sick days per year.
